Title: Luc Van Ginneken: Innovator in Biodiesel Production
Introduction
Luc Van Ginneken is a notable inventor based in Balen, Belgium. He has made significant contributions to the field of biodiesel production, holding 2 patents that focus on innovative methods for creating fatty acid esters and biodiesel.
Latest Patents
One of his latest patents is a method for preparing fatty acid esters with alcohol recycling. This method produces fatty acid esters by transesterification of fats and oils using alcohol at high pressure and temperature. Unreacted alcohol is separated inline from the reaction mixture and continuously recycled into the transesterification process. The separation is achieved by obtaining a vapor phase and higher density phases of the reaction mixture, concentrating the alcohol in the vapor phase.
Another significant patent is for producing biodiesel using an immobilized catalyst. This method produces a fatty acid alkyl ester by transesterification of fat or oil and alcohol. The reaction is catalyzed by a heterogeneous catalyst immobilized in a tubular reactor at temperatures between 260 and 420°C and at pressures higher than 5 bar. A mixture of fat or oil and alcohol is led in a continuous flow through the tubular reactor. The catalyst is preferably a metal oxide or a metal carbonate, including an alkaline earth metal. This innovative approach allows the reaction to take place at reduced residence and contact times compared to prior art.
Career Highlights
Luc Van Ginneken has worked with the Flemish Institute for Technological Research (VITO), where he has contributed to various research projects focused on sustainable energy solutions. His work has been instrumental in advancing the technology behind biodiesel production.
Collaborations
Some of his notable coworkers include Kathy Elst and Jo Sijben, who have collaborated with him on various projects within the field of biodiesel and sustainable energy.
